The Campus Safety and Security Department relies upon everyone's cooperation and involvement in maintaining a safe and secure environment. Everyone can help to assure the safety and security of themselves, as well as those around them by following a common sense approach:




Purses, wallets, and other personal effects should not be left unsecured in unoccupied areas.
Staff should insure office and classroom doors are locked when unoccupied.
Always lock your car doors, and secure valuables in the trunk, or out of plain view.
When walking about campus, present yourself in an assertive and confident manner — trust your instincts and ask for help if you feel you may need it.

Members of the community are encouraged to use campus escort services when returning to their vehicles late at night. Crimes occur during the day as well as at night.
